**Garage feed ingestion — reviewer notes**

The occupancy feed from the Larkspur Deck garages arrives via the Stallfinder poller every 90 seconds. Please verify that the reviewer checklist covers backoff behavior when the feed stalls, since stale counts propagate to the wayfinding signs. The poller authenticates to the Stallfinder upstream using a token loaded from `config/.env`, which must contain exactly this line:

secret setting of tawif-tajop: COURIER_KEY13=819c65d82d2bd

Bulk edits in the Quillhaven admin table now require a dry-run pass before commit. Select rows, apply the change set, and review the diff panel; nothing persists until confirm. If more than 500 rows are affected, the job queues into Harrowmill and runs async. Failed batches roll back atomically. Check the job ledger before retrying. The token for the last successful batch appears below.

pipeline stamp: htk21_86b657ac0aa916a9af17f

## Deployment

The nightly reindex for Quillhaven Search runs as a scheduled job on the batch cluster, kicking off at 02:00 local cluster time. It rebuilds the full document index from the primary store, swaps aliases atomically, and retains the previous index for one cycle as a rollback target. Reviewers should check that index mapping changes are backward compatible, since the swap is all-or-nothing. The job reads its parameters from the values below.

settings of bahip-yagef:
zorvan:
  pin: 0198
  tenant: caswyn
  seal: seal_a58b6b6a
  metrics_host: metrics.zorvan.sivrelnet.local
  standby_team: silwyn
  escalation: rusvan-gilox
  nonce: 477a13

Quick update for branch managers: after months of back-and-forth, leadership has decided to expand Line 3 at Brindlemoor rather than commissioning a new site near Fenwick Hollow. It's cheaper, faster, and keeps the experienced crew together. Expect a bump in throughput targets from next quarter, plus some temporary scheduling headaches while the fitters are in. Don't circulate this beyond your direct reports just yet — the official announcement lands in two weeks. The confidential note on our wider plans is below.

confidential, kagup-bafog: Fraaxax Group is in early talks to buy Soroxox Group for about $343.8 million. The Olidor launch date is June 14, and nothing goes to the press before then. Legal wants the Aldmirek Logistics term sheet signed before July 23.